## Job Content

### Job overview

An interesting and varied vacancy for 0.8 WTE (30 hours) has become available for an innovative and dynamic Band 6 Mental Health Nurse Practitioner to work for Lancaster and Morecambe Older Adults Community Mental Health Team (CMHT).

The successful candidate will have sound clinical and leadership skills, be enthusiastic about the role and its development and be driven to provide excellent mental health services to the local older adult population.

### Main duties of the job

Ideally applicants should have experience of working with older adults with mental health needs and the ability to lead on assessment and provide treatment plans. They should also have excellent communication skills.

The role will involve working within a Multi Disciplinary Team to support older adult service users on the dementia diagnostic pathway and in the community to remain at home and prevent hospital admission.

## Person Specification

### Knowledge

**Essential**

- Understanding of Health and Safety policies and procedures
- Knowledge and practice of Mental Health Act 1983
- Knowledge and practice of the Mental Capacity Act 2005

### Experience

**Essential**

- Post graduate experience
- Supervision and management of staff
- Experience of assessing, planning and implementing and reviewing care needs
- Experienced in acting as a mentor/assessor of student staff

### Qualifications

**Essential**

- Registered Mental Health Nurse Degree
- On-going registration with the NMC
- Specialist qualification or equivalent level in skills and development
- Mentorship qualification
